General Emilio Aguinaldo

Emilio Aguinaldo was a Filipino revolutionary leader and the first President of the Philippines, serving from 1899 to 1901. Born in 1869, he played a key role in the country's fight for independence from Spanish colonial rule, declaring independence in 1898. Aguinaldo led Filipino forces during the Philippine Revolution and later fought against American colonizers after the Spanish-American War. His leadership helped shape the nation's early political identity, although his presidency faced challenges and controversies. He remains a national hero recognized for his dedication to Filipino independence and sovereignty.
